District 504 Facilitator

Lake Dallas Independent School District
Dallas, TX Full Time
POSTED ON 7/23/2025 CLOSED ON 8/13/2025

Job Title:             District 504 Facilitator                                                    Exemption Status/Test: Exempt

Reports to:         Director of Special Programs                                       Pay Grade:                                         

Dept./School:    Special Programs                                                                                     


Primary Purpose:

Responsible for coordinating compliance with the federal and state assessment system and Section 504 requirements. 

Qualifications:

Education/Certification:

Bachelor’s degree

Valid Texas Certification

Special Knowledge/Skills/Abilities:

         Strong organizational, communication, and interpersonal skills

Experience:

5 years classroom teaching experience

Major Responsibilities and Duties:

  1. Participate in district-level decision-making process to establish and review the district’s goals and objectives.
  2. Actively support the efforts of others to achieve district goals and campus performance objectives.
  3. Assist in providing effective staff development activities that incorporate the mission of the district, program evaluation outcomes, and input from teachers and others.
  4. Assist in the implementation of policies established by federal and state law, State Board of Education rule, and local board policy in the area of curriculum and instruction.
  5. Compile, maintain, and present all reports, records, and other documents required.
  6. Provide district wide testing and data analysis.
  7. Maintain and collect auditable documentation for state accountability testing as well as review materials for return.
  8. Serve as the district Section 504 Coordinator for student services working collaboratively with campus 504 coordinators and administrators.
  9. Set forth operational guidelines for Section 504 procedures.
  10. Develop and ensure the implementation of procedures and requirements for identifying and providing educational and related services to those students who have disabilities.
  11. Provides annual training and on-going support to district staff regarding Section 504 and the implementation of Section 504 procedures.
  12. Collect and maintain all Section 504 student data for future reference.
  13. Maintain a campus database of 504 students throughout the district.
  14. Ensure 504 Campus Coordinators solve problems as they relate to parents, students, or teachers regarding 504.
  15. Work with campus administrators in choosing appropriate staff for Campus 504 Coordinator positions, including serving as a campus coordinator themselves when needed..
  16. Coordinate with special education, dyslexia, RtI and ESL departments, regarding procedures for proper identification and placement of 504 students.
  17. Communicate with other districts regarding 504 students enrolling or withdrawing.
  18. Stay current with all federal laws regarding Section 504.
  19. Demonstrate responsible fiscal control over assigned program budgets.
  20. Perform other duties, as assigned, including but not limited to serving as the LEA representative for ARD meetings.

 

Other

  1. Follow district safety protocols and emergency procedures

Mental Demands/Physical Demands/Environmental Factors:

Tools/Equipment Used: Standard office equipment including personal computer and peripherals

Posture: Prolonged sitting; occasional bending/stooping, pushing/pulling, twisting

Motion: Repetitive hand motions, frequent keyboarding and use of mouse

Lifting: Occasional light lifting and carrying (under 15 pounds)

Environment: Occasional districtwide and statewide travel

Mental Demands: Work with frequent interruptions; maintain emotional control under stress
